22 dcaegen2-services-common.filebeatConfiguration:
23 This template generates configuration data for filebeat (log file aggregation).
25 The template is used to create a configMap mounted by a filebeat sidecar pod
26 running alongside a DCAE microservice pod.
28 See dcaegen2-services-common.configMap for more information.
